CMake: Don't hard-code "libexec" in qt-configure-module
If INSTALL_LIBEXECDIR was set to something != "libexec", qt-configure-module contained the wrong path to qt-cmake. Fixes: QTBUG-128137 Pick-to: 6.5 6.7 6.8 Change-Id: Ic095ff8cb804bbdd72e238e75ac867b7cc3bd478 Reviewed-by: Alexey Edelev <alexey.edelev@qt.io>
